More than 300 industry leaders are to gather next week at the inaugural Iran Hotel and Tourism Investment
Conference (IHTIC). H.E. Dr. Zahra Ahmadipour, Vice President - Head of Iran's Cultural Heritage, Handicrafts and
Tourism Organization (ICHHTO), will open the conference alongside Ahmad Jamali, General Director for Foreign
Investment at the Ministry of Economic Affairs and Finance. Two days of panel discussions and thought leadership
presentations by leading industry experts will follow, along with a unique chance to hear political leaders' views
first-hand and opportunities to network with prominent investors, developers and operators.According to the latest
Euromonitor report "Travel in Iran", Iran is, without a doubt, the new up-and-coming tourism destination, and is
likely to become the leading tourism market in the MENA region, provided that the infrastructure is able to develop
and cope with changes. President Hassan Rouhani is determined to boost tourism and encourage foreign investment
and the Iran Cultural Heritage, Handicrafts and Tourism Organisation is working on this hand in hand with local
municipalities to attract more investors. An increasing number of investors are eyeing the opportunities in Iran,
however, there are still regulatory and red tape hurdles in the process. Dr. Saeed Shirkavand, Deputy of Planning
and Investment at Iran's Cultural Heritage, Handicrafts and Tourism Organization (ICHHTO), will take to the stage
next week to present investment opportunities in Iran.
